The Matrix Revolutions (2003)

The Matrix Revolutions

Everything that has a beginning has an end. 2003/11/5 129 Min.
Your rating:
6.6 5318 votes


Lilly Wachowski
Lilly Wachowski
Lana Wachowski
Lana Wachowski


Keanu Reeves is Thomas A. Anderson / Neo
Keanu Reeves
Thomas A. Anderson / Neo
Laurence Fishburne is Morpheus
Laurence Fishburne
Carrie-Anne Moss is Trinity
Carrie-Anne Moss
Hugo Weaving is Agent Smith
Hugo Weaving
Agent Smith
Mary Alice is Oracle
Mary Alice
Helmut Bakaitis is The Architect
Helmut Bakaitis
The Architect
Lambert Wilson is The Merovingian
Lambert Wilson
The Merovingian
Roy Jones Jr. is Captain Ballard
Roy Jones Jr.
Captain Ballard
Randall Duk Kim is The Keymaker
Randall Duk Kim
The Keymaker
Harry Lennix is Commander Lock
Harry Lennix
Commander Lock


The human town of Zion defends itself in opposition to the massive invasion of the machines as Neo fights to end the battle at another front at the same time as also opposing the rogue Agent Smith.

Original title The Matrix Revolutions
TMDb Rating 6.6 5318 votes

Movie review

Leave your comment!